To better support cloud deployments, Ambari should be able to recognize that 
packages have already been preinstalled on the VM image, and skip the INSTALL 
commands. Based on the measurements with latest Ambari 2.0 and HDP 2.2, INSTALL 
phase takes ~3 minutes, so skipping these steps will contribute significantly 
to the overall deployment latency.

Things are not as strait forward as mentioned above, as some components might 
do some steps beyond just INSTALL, but that's ok given that these are 
exceptions we can handle/eliminate on case-by-case basis.

Ambari preinstall and postinstall hooks can generally be run only once during 
sys-prep so there shouldn't be any problems there.
